Summary of the Market
On January 22, the benchmark Nifty Index rose by 0.57% to close at 23155.3. The Nifty Midcap150 Index fell by 1.25% to close at 19696.9. The Nifty Smallcap250 Index fell by 1.6% to close at 16220.8. The Nifty Total Market Index rose by 0.22% to close at 12064.7.The 10yr yield remained unchanged at 6.75%. The rupee gained 0.25% to close at 86.38 against the US Dollar.
Important Notables
- SEBI proposes bit-sized SIPs of ₹250 to expand mutual fund reach in underserved sections, reports BS.
- Smartphones have become India’s second-largest export category, as per WTO’s harmonized system codes for international trade, reports BS.
- Vedanta Limited plans to raise ₹4,000 crore through rupee-denominated non-convertible debentures, offering a 9.75% return to investors, reports ET.
- India plans to form a consortium with public sector enterprises' equity participation to bid for operating overseas port assets, reports ET.
- Domestic air passenger traffic rose 6.12% year-on-year in 2024 to 161.3 million, as per Directorate General of Civil Aviation data, reports BS.
- The government has increased the MSP of raw jute by 2.35 times to ₹5,650/quintal for the 2024-25 season, up from ₹2,400/quintal in 2014-15, reports FE.
- BSNL, which gained mobile users following private telecom operators' tariff hikes in July last year, is now witnessing subscriber losses, reports FE.
- EVs and hybrid vehicles are affecting India’s petrol and diesel consumption, which makes up over 60% of refined product usage in the world’s third-largest crude oil consumer, reports BL.
